Community Participation in Wannanup

How people contribute — volunteering, unpaid care and domestic work, and defence service.

Very few people volunteer in Wannanup compared to similar areas, though the area has a remarkably high number of former Defence Force members. While local volunteering is low, a significant portion of the community is active in unpaid care and housework.

Participation

Volunteering for organisations and groups.

Only 12.3% of residents volunteer, a figure that is much lower than most areas and well below the Western Australian rate of 15.9%.

Unpaid care & work

Caring for others and unpaid domestic work.

More people here do unpaid housework than the national figure, with 25.2% spending 15 or more hours a week on it. Around 28.3% provide unpaid childcare, which is higher than most areas.

Defence service

People who served in the Australian Defence Force.

A much higher proportion of people have served in the Defence Force here than in most similar areas, with 4.6% of residents having served.
